bguppies Posted October 13, 2008 #6 Share Posted October 13, 2008 On the subject, what kind of NFL games can I expect in the sports bar? You will get whatever games are shown in Denver Colorado the week you sail. (so you are guaranteed the Broncos as one game) You get the Denver CBS and Fox and Denver NBC game at 8PM. You will get the ESPN International feed of MNF, with Tirico, Jaws and Kornheiser speaking in English, but all on screen graphics are in Espanol. Just check an online TV Guide for Denver to see exactly which games you will see. Bill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
